Overview
An exhibition page-flipping system is a cutting-edge interactive display technology designed to replicate the tactile experience of flipping through a physical book. It is commonly used in museums, trade shows, and corporate exhibitions to present digital content in an engaging and intuitive manner. The system typically includes a high-resolution screen, sensors for touch or gesture recognition, and software that renders page-flipping animations. This technology is particularly popular for showcasing product catalogs, historical archives, and multimedia presentations. It enhances visitor interaction by allowing them to navigate through content at their own pace, making it a valuable tool for educational and promotional purposes.
Structure and Working Principle
The exhibition page-flipping system consists of several key components: a display screen, sensors (such as infrared or capacitive touch sensors), a processing unit, and specialized software. The display screen is usually a large, high-definition monitor or projection screen that renders the digital pages. Sensors detect user interactions, such as swipes or touches, and send signals to the processing unit. The software then interprets these signals to simulate the page-flipping effect, complete with animations and sound effects. Advanced systems may also incorporate gesture recognition, allowing users to flip pages by waving their hands in front of the screen. The combination of hardware and software ensures a seamless and immersive user experience.

Maintenance and Precautions
To ensure the longevity and optimal performance of an exhibition page-flipping system, regular maintenance is essential. The display screen should be cleaned periodically to prevent dust and smudges from affecting visibility. Sensors and processing units should be checked for firmware updates to ensure compatibility with the latest software. Precautions include avoiding exposure to extreme temperatures and humidity, which can damage electronic components. It is also important to calibrate the sensors regularly to maintain accurate touch or gesture recognition. Proper handling during transportation and installation can prevent physical damage to the system. Following these maintenance and precautionary measures will help extend the system's lifespan and ensure a smooth user experience.
B2B Procurement Guide
When procuring an exhibition page-flipping system for B2B purposes, several factors should be considered. First, evaluate the system's display quality and resolution to ensure it meets your content presentation needs. High-resolution screens are essential for crisp and clear visuals. Next, consider the interactivity options, such as touch, gesture, or remote control, and choose the one that best suits your target audience. Content management capabilities are another critical factor. Ensure the system supports easy updates and customization of digital content. Additionally, assess the vendor's reputation, after-sales support, and warranty offerings. Price is also an important consideration, with systems ranging from approximately $2,000 to $10,000 depending on features and specifications. Prioritize systems that offer the best balance of quality, functionality, and cost.
